Lumbar disc herniation, a common condition. Typical symptoms: Low back pain plus sciatica. It’s a long story, we crawled before we evolved to walk upright. Between each of our lumbar vertebrae, there is an intervertebral disc, like a spring. When crawling, the discs were under very little pressure. After standing upright, the pressure on the intervertebral discs increases significantly. Over time, the intervertebral disc finally bear i can not stand the pressure, the elasticity of the decline, backward protrusion. When it protrudes, it presses on the nerve behind it, so sciatica occurs. (Because this nerve is responsible for the feeling of the leg). Therefore, this disease, pain (or numbness) in the legs, the root of the disease in the waist.
